What to Expect
Step 1: Positioning
Mark where the bolts will go - usually one near the top and one near the bottom of the door, on the hinge side.
Step 2: Drilling
Drill holes in the door edge for the bolts, then matching holes in the doorframe for them to engage into.
Step 3: Fitting & Testing
Install the bolts, test the door closes properly and the bolts engage fully when the door is shut.
🔧 DIY Tips
If you're confident with a drill, you can fit these yourself:
🔧 What you'll need
- Hinge bolts (2-3 per door)
- Power drill
- Drill bits (size depends on bolt size)
- Pencil and tape measure
- Chisel (might need to recess bolt housings)
📐 How to fit hinge bolts
- Close and lock the door
- Mark positions on door edge - one at 200mm from top, one at 200mm from bottom
- Drill hole in door edge for bolt housing (check bolt instructions for size)
- Insert bolt into door, mark where it touches the frame
- Drill matching hole in frame for bolt to engage
- Test door closes and bolts engage properly
- If bolt catches, deepen frame hole slightly
⚠️ Common DIY mistakes
- Holes not aligned (bolt doesn't engage)
- Bolt housing not flush (door won't close)
- Frame hole too shallow (bolt doesn't engage fully)
- Wrong size drill bit (bolt loose or won't fit)
- Damaging door by drilling at angle
💡 Pro trick: Use masking tape on your drill bit at the correct depth. Stops you drilling too deep and coming out the other side of the door.

Frequently Asked Questions
What do hinge bolts actually do?
They stop someone removing your door by lifting it off the hinges. Even if the hinge pins are exposed on the outside (which they shouldn't be but often are), the bolts engage into the frame and prevent the door being lifted out.
Do I need hinge bolts if my hinges are on the inside?
Not essential but recommended. Internal hinges mean the pins can't be knocked out from outside, but hinge bolts add an extra layer of security and most insurance companies like them fitted.
How many do I need per door?
Two minimum - one near the top, one near the bottom. On taller doors or if you want maximum security, three bolts (top, middle, bottom) is even better.
Will they damage my door?
I need to drill holes for the bolts - one in the door edge, matching hole in the frame. It's permanent, but it's also proper security. Can't really be done any other way.
Do they work with all locks?
Yes - hinge bolts are independent of your main lock. They work alongside it for extra security. Fitted on the hinge side while your lock is on the opening side.
